7 gift-card questions answered

  • What denominations can I buy gift cards in? Is there a limit to how many cards I can purchase?

    Great question. Every budget is different, and we’re happy to sell gift cards for as little as $1 and as much as $500. There’s no limit to the number of cards you can purchase, so if a Beer Store gift card is your go-to for family, friends and neighbours, grab as many as you like in whatever denomination you wish within that range.


  • Can I order gift cards online?

    Unfortunately, no. We don’t offer digital gift cards. But the good news is that we have hundreds of stores across the province that are stocked with gift cards for you to purchase on your next visit. Our gift cards are also reloadable, making them an easy way to collect your empties money to spend on your favourite beer or to gift to someone else later on. Click here to find a store near you.


  • Can I spend my gift card online?

    At this time, gift cards can only be used in-store. This means that if you’re planning to give a gift card to someone, you’ll want to make sure that they have a Beer Store location nearby. And if you’re thinking of ordering them some beer, hold that thought. While it’s a really nice gesture to want to send a friend some suds from us, government regulations state that we can only sell beer within the province of Ontario, so if they live outside of the province (or the country), it isn’t an option.

  • Can gift cards be transferred to another person?

    Since our gift cards are physical, like cash, they can be transferred over. If you have a gift card you want to hand over to someone else, please feel free to make their day. The only requirement is that all cardholders must be at least 19 years of age to use the gift card to purchase alcohol. The cardholder can be under 19 to use the card to collect empties money or to purchase non-alcoholic items.

  • Do gift cards expire?

    Nope! No expiration date in sight. You’re good to load and reload your gift card again and again with no extra fees or charges. Just remember that gift cards have no redeemable value until they’ve been purchased and activated in-store.

  • What happens if I lose my gift card?

    Because Beer Store gift cards are almost like cash, we can’t issue a replacement for a lost, stolen or damaged card unless it’s been registered online. For this reason, it’s a really good idea to register your gift card. It only takes a second, and you can register your card here.

  • How do I check my balance?

    Oh, that’s an easy one. To check your gift card balance, simply enter your card number at this link and click that you’re not a robot (unless, of course, you are a robot) to reveal the balance. If this is a card that you’ve reloaded, the addition to your balance will happen in real time.
